Eleni Apostolaki is a scholar working on Surgery, Orthopedics and Sports Medicine and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Eleni Apostolaki has authored 8 papers receiving a total of 502 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Surgery, 3 papers in Orthopedics and Sports Medicine and 2 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Eleni Apostolaki’s work include Sports injuries and prevention (2 papers), Infectious Diseases and Tuberculosis (2 papers) and Orthopedic Infections and Treatments (2 papers). Eleni Apostolaki is often cited by papers focused on Sports injuries and prevention (2 papers), Infectious Diseases and Tuberculosis (2 papers) and Orthopedic Infections and Treatments (2 papers). Eleni Apostolaki collaborates with scholars based in Greece and United Kingdom. Eleni Apostolaki's co-authors include A. Voloudaki, Nicholas Gourtsoyiannis, Kalliopi Stefanaki, E. Magkanas, Panagiotis Prassopoulos, M. Daskalogiannaki, Victor N. Cassar‐Pullicino, N. Evans, A. M. Davies and Demosthenes Bouros and has published in prestigious journals such as American Journal of Roentgenology, European Radiology and European Journal of Radiology.
